Just a quick query which it appears impossible to find out via Northern Rail or Travel South Yorkshire.

Trains between Sheffield and Barnsley are replaced by buses all this weekend (11-12 July), unfortunately the timetables don't say where in Sheffield the buses leave from. Previously I'm sure they used to line up at the taxi rank by the drop off car park, but I'm sure that when TPE had bus replacements earlier this year they left from Sheffield Interchange rather than the station itself.

Anyone have any idea?

The Northern Rail website says:
"Sheffield: Pick up / drop off at bus stand E1 or E2 in the bus station."

This was in the Enigneering works section of the website; it's a bit weird and I had to fiddle with it to get this info.

(For Barnsley it says the buses stop outside the station as expected).

They go from the bus interchange a couple of minutes away from the train station.

If you're not familiar with it walk out of the main exit of the station, cross over the pedestrian crossing and there's a little covered walkway to your right. That brings you out right in front of the bus station, go through the entrance directly opposite the walkway and rail replacements normally go from the first two stands on the right hand side.
